Publisher's Summary

The Vanderbeekers have always lived in the brownstone on 141st Street. It's practically a member of the family. So when their reclusive, curmudgeonly landlord decides not to renew their lease, the five siblings have 11 days to do whatever it takes to stay in their beloved home and convince the dreaded landlord just how wonderful they are...and all is fair in love and war when it comes to keeping their home.

"A DIFFERENT DIMENSION WORTH EXPLORING"

Spectacular book, intriguing. Shows how one can change their perspective about things, how things can be misunderstood and taken as a different thing. Everything one person thinks is not always right. It shows how team work can help you achieve and that kids aren't as helpless as many think they are. Overcome shyness , resolve battles among us and half the greater battle is won. Music is a little something that people can hear, but most importantly feel. It's a little slice of heaven, if you ask me. Don't just read the book, step into it. Miraculously, a lot of the things in the book are things I can relate to, unlike most books, where you wish you were the character. This book shows how you can spark the magic in your own normal (slightly boring) life.
